'Kuratong Baleleng' suspect slain in shootout
MANILA, Philippines - A suspected member of the “Kuratong Baleleng” crime gang was killed in an alleged running gunbattle with police from Taguig to Makati City Thursday night.
Senior Superintendent Camilo Cascolan, Taguig City police chief, identified the suspect as Ramil Pacana, alias Vicvic, a resident of Pateros.
Pacana, who sustained a gunshot wound in the head, was rushed to the Ospital ng Makati but died while undergoing treatment at around 10:10 p.m.
According to a report, a police team was patrolling along Carlos P. Garcia street in Taguig at around 6:10 p.m. when they spotted the suspect, who was on foot, with something bulging around his waist.
As the policemen approached, the suspect shot at them while running toward J.P. Rizal Avenue in Barangay East Rembo in Makati City. Pacana was shot in the head, reportedly during the chase.
Cascolan said the suspect has pending cases for carjacking and robbery in Pateros.
The Kuratong Baleleng crime gang’s name became a byword in 1999 when 11 alleged members were reportedly killed by the Presidential Anti-Crime Commission, led by fugitive Sen. Panfilo Lacson, who was then chief of the Philippine National Police.
